What can an Excel virtual assistant do for you?

Excel virtual assistants can do a wide variety of tasks, including:

  • Data entry: Excel virtual assistants can enter data into Excel spreadsheets quickly and accurately. They can also format data and create tables.
  • Data formatting: Excel virtual assistants can format data in a way that is consistent and easy to read. They can also create custom number formats, date formats, and time formats.
  • Data analysis: Excel virtual assistants can use Excel’s built-in data analysis tools to analyze data and identify trends. They can also create custom formulas and functions to perform complex calculations.
  • Creating and managing formulas: Excel virtual assistants can create and manage complex Excel formulas. They can also help you to troubleshoot Excel formula problems.
  • Creating charts and graphs: Excel virtual assistants can create a variety of charts and graphs to visualize data and make it easier to understand.
  • Building dashboards: Excel virtual assistants can build dashboards to track key performance indicators (KPIs) and other important data.
  • Automating tasks: Excel virtual assistants can automate repetitive tasks, such as sending email reports or generating invoices.
  • Troubleshooting Excel problems: Excel virtual assistants can help you to troubleshoot Excel problems, such as errors in formulas or functions.

How to find a qualified Excel virtual assistant

There are a few different ways to find a qualified Excel virtual assistant. You can search online job boards, or you can contact a virtual assistant agency.

When looking for an Excel virtual assistant, be sure to consider the following factors:

  • Experience: Make sure that the virtual assistant has experience working with Excel.
  • Skills: Make sure that the virtual assistant has the skills necessary to perform the tasks that you need help with.
  • Availability: Make sure that the virtual assistant is available to work the hours that you need them to work.
  • Communication skills: Make sure that the virtual assistant is able to communicate effectively with you.

Tips for working with an Excel virtual assistant

Once you have found a qualified Excel virtual assistant, there are a few things you can do to ensure a successful working relationship:

  • Be clear about your expectations: Make sure that the virtual assistant understands exactly what you need them to do.
  • Provide clear instructions: Give the virtual assistant clear and concise instructions for each task.
  • Give feedback: Let the virtual assistant know how they are doing and provide feedback on their work.
  • Be patient and understanding: It may take some time for the virtual assistant to get up to speed on your specific needs and processes. Be patient and understanding as they learn.
